English Language Versions

KJV   Now is she without, now in the streets, and lieth in wait at every corner.)
KJVP   Now H6471 is she without, H2351 now H6471 in the streets, H7339 and lieth in wait H693 at H681 every H3605 corner. H6438 )
YLT   Now in an out-place, now in broad places, And near every corner she lieth in wait) --
ASV   Now she is in the streets, now in the broad places, And lieth in wait at every corner.
WEB   Now she is in the streets, now in the squares, And lurking at every corner.
RV   Now she is in the streets, now in the broad places, and lieth in wait at every corner.
NET   at one time outside, at another in the wide plazas, and by every corner she lies in wait.)
ERVEN   She walked the streets, always looking for someone to trap.
